3Media Networks’ 3Music TV, officially launched and opened its doors on Friday 16th September 2022 in a carefully planned event that had several industry players present.
One year down the line, the entertainment-focused, youth-oriented television station has warmed its way into the hearts of audiences, both in and outside Ghana, first with its flagship morning show, Culture Daily. 3Music TV has set itself apart over the months, positioning the Culture Daily morning as a positive, delightful, conversation-generating, industry-supportive, entertainment show.
With Culture Daily’s consistency creating top of mind awareness in the minds of target audience and demographics beyond and younger, 3Music TV in the past three months has onboarded three new shows - Chef It Up, Just Vibes and Game On - cooking, youthful tell-all and sports shows respectively.
To ceremonialize the first year, 3Music TV will rollout a number on-air content and off-air driven activities in celebration with its followers and viewers.

Lanez' request for bail is met with skepticism from legal experts. Michael Freedman of The Freedman Firm explained that to obtain bail pending an appeal, Lanez must demonstrate a substantial likelihood of prevailing on appeal, typically by showing errors made by the trial judge.

The Recording Academy CEO, Harvey Mason Jr., confirmed that the track is eligible for consideration at the Grammy Awards. This is because it was composed and arranged by a human, even though AI processed the vocals to mimic the two famous singers.
